A Birth Ahead of Schedule
Shea Joelle James was born on June 14, 2007, in Los Angeles, California, arriving two weeks earlier than her parents expected. Named after the legendary Shea Stadium, a nod to her father’s allegiance to the New York Mets, she began life wrapped in familial warmth and humor. Her birth brought added joy to parents Kevin James and Steffiana de la Cruz, as she joined big sister Sienna-Marie and later became part of a lively, loving household filled with entertainment and affection.

Sibling Bonds: A Close-Knit Quartet
Shea is the second child of four—with older sister Sienna-Marie (b. 2005), younger brother Kannon Valentine (b. 2011), and youngest sister Sistine Sabella (b. 2015). Their close ages encourage both camaraderie and playful sibling dynamics, growing up with shared experiences like acting cameos and musical family projects. Their brother’s piano playing and joint stage performances further strengthen their bond, rooted in creativity and mutual support.
First Glance at the Camera
Beginning with her role in Paul Blart: Mall Cop 2 (2015), Shea took her first steps before an audience—as a “Little Girl” in a film starring her father. That debut, though modest, introduced her to how film sets blend structured roles with childhood wonder—a gentle initiation into performance shaped by familial trust.
On-Screen Roles: Building a Resume
In the same year, Shea appeared in Pixels, playing a classroom scout girl. She later appeared in Kevin Can Wait as “Lucy,” sharing scenes with her sister, and portrayed “Cooky’s Friend” in Hubie Halloween (2020). Community and Shared Performance
In 2022, Shea and her siblings performed in Oliver!—a community musical where she played Bet. This shared theater experience brought artistic joy, sibling collaboration, and public expression in a nurturing setting, affirming her growing confidence and stage presence.
